Flex: X-Out Label? - PullRequest
       1

Flex: X-Out Label?

1 голос
/ 06 мая 2009

Я пытаюсь создать ярлык с надписью X Например, я могу сказать, что это цена с Х над ценой. Я хочу сделать его компонентом, потому что собираюсь использовать его не раз. Я хочу, чтобы размер X был близок к размеру текста, чтобы он не был гигантским X над маленьким текстом или маленьким X над большим текстом.

Вот код, который я пробовал, который вообще ничего не делал:

<?xml version="1.0" encoding="utf-8"?>
<mx:Label xmlns:mx="http://www.adobe.com/2006/mxml">

    <mx:Script>
        <![CDATA[

            override public function set text(value:String):void
            {
                super.text = value;

                var g:Graphics = this.graphics;
                g.clear();
                g.lineStyle(3,0xFF0000);
                g.lineTo(this.width,this.height);
                g.moveTo(0,this.height);
                g.lineTo(this.width,0);
            }       

        ]]>
    </mx:Script>

</mx:Label>

1 Ответ

1 голос
/ 06 мая 2009

См. этот пост. Он предоставляет компонент, который сделает это за вас.

В настоящее время не поддерживается изначально.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...